Funniest Moment: Asher "accidentally" smashing the laptop of that creepy jerk who was bothering Colby.
WTH? Moment: Erica Kane got abducted! The whole thing happened so suddenly, it was almost like we couldn't believe what we saw.
Performer of the Week: Sarah Glendening as Marissa Tasker. We're loving what she's doing with the role of Marissa -- she's a total badass lawyer who knows how to let her hair down and have fun after hours. No wonder Bianca's developing such a crush on her.
Best Moment: Griffin getting stabbed in jail. Not the "best" moment because we loved it (we've grown quite fond of Griff) but because it was such a shocking, compelling moment.
Why We Love All My Children This Week: Watching Cara Finn do her thing. From fiercely defending her brother to the cops, to continuing her rather cute marriage to Tad, to rushing to Griff's rescue in jail.
